Police are releasing an E-Fit of a man they wish to speak to in relation to an abduction of a 17-year-old girl in Dewsbury.
Kirklees CID would like to speak to anyone who recognises this man or has any information about the incident which happened on 21 February this year.
At around 10:30pm the 17-year-old victim was forced into a car, which was described as a three door dark vehicle on Huddersfield Road, Westtown, in Dewsbury.
She was driven to Bradford and Halifax before being driven back to Dewsbury where he attempted to sexually assault her but she managed to get away from him.
The male suspect is described as an Asian male, dark brown eyes, dark curly hair and beard and in his 20's.
DC Michael Smith, of Kirklees CID, said: "We are investigating this incident and would like to speak to anyone who recognises this man pictured in the E-Fit.
"The victim is extremely distressed by the incident and we are keen to locate this man. I would like to stress that this is an isolated incident and no other incidents have been reported.
"Anyone who has any information is asked to contact myself at Kirklees CID via 101 quoting reference 13160078532 or call Crimestoppers anonymously on 0800 555 111."
